Full Length (100 minute estimated runtime)
UPDATED (6/8/2026)
After a lobotomy, using a railroad spike and a Viking style battle axe, goes terribly wrong, Dr. Lee Botomy finds himself at the center of a scandal. In order to keep his job, and get the public back on his side, he decides to try to break a world record set by his idol. When teamed up with a shoulder pad obsessed president, a loyal assistant, a surfer nurse, and a delivery person with a killer right hook, you'll be left asking: "Who knew one of the most controversial psychiatric procedures could be so hilarious?"
